I decided to try using this promising whitening soap in the hopes of solving my acne marks and dark spots problem. Patience is a virtue as we always say, so I waited to see any results until I used it all up. It lasted for about 2 months. According to a beauty company, one month is supposedly enough for you to see a little difference. So, did I see any difference after 2 months? Keep reading.
FEATURES

- Effectively eliminates dirt, cleanses, whitens and helps reduce the signs of aging on your skin with Helston (famous beauty ingredient in Japan).
- Easily lightens your complexion with the fusing performance of Horse Placental Protein, Japan Patented Marine Placental Protein, Cucumber Juice and Ryoku-cha Ekisu.
- Gently exfoliates your skin with Lactic, Malic and Citric Acid to prevent premature aging and improve skin conditions like spots, freckles, fine lines and excessive dryness.
- Normalizes your skin’s moisture and provides suppleness with Algae Extract, and Hydrolyzed Collagen.
- Protects your skin from harmful UV rays with Sericin.
PROS

- good scent
- nice packaging
- I didn’t experience any allergic reaction.
- gentle on the skin
- paraben free
- not gooey
CONS
- Doesn’t lather up well.
- My skin appeared to be dry.
- Even after 2 months, there was no whitening effect on the dark spots.
- Expensive
It was a bit disappointing like I only paid for nothing. On the other hand, I can still appreciate it for having no paraben in it. Just to be fair, I’m not saying this is a bad product but it wasn’t effective for me so I’m not going to recommend it.
